| 01-31699 | Airworthiness Directives; Rolls-Royce, plc RB211 Trent 800 Series Turbofan Engines | Rule | This amendment supersedes an existing airworthiness directive (AD) that is applicable to Rolls-Royce, plc RB211 Trent 800 series turbofan engines. That AD currently requires initial and repetitive ultrasonic inspections of low pressure compressor (LPC) fan blade roots for cracks, and replacement, if necessary, with serviceable parts. This amendment requires initial inspections at modified thresholds and repetitive inspections at reduced intervals from the current AD using new LPC fan blade inspection criteria, and requires renewal of dry film lubricant on removed blades. This amendment is prompted by reports that an in-service engine experienced LPC fan blade root cracking at a lower life than previously forecast, and, the manufacturer's further investigation that has led to a better understanding of the causes of fan blade root cracking. | 01-32044 | Random Drug Testing Rate for Covered Crewmembers | Notice | The Coast Guard has set the calendar year 2002 minimum random drug testing rate at 50 percent of covered crewmembers. An evaluation of the 2000 Management Information System (MIS) data collection forms submitted by marine employers determined that random drug testing on covered crewmembers for the calendar year 2000 resulted in positive test results 1.81 percent of the time. Based on this percentage, we will maintain the minimum random drug testing rate at 50 percent of covered crewmembers for the calendar year 2002. | 2001-12-31 | 2001 | 12 | https://www.federalregister.gov/documents/2001/12/31/01-32044/random-drug-testing-rate-for-covered-crewmembers | https://www.govinfo.gov/content/pkg/FR-2001-12-31/pdf/01-32044.pdf | Transportation Department; Coast Guard | 492,53 | The Coast Guard has set the calendar year 2002 minimum random drug testing rate at 50 percent of covered crewmembers. | 01-32048 | Alcohol/Drug Regulations: Temporary Post-Accident Blood Testing Procedures | Notice | Some of the existing FRA post-accident toxicology testing (PATT) kits contain blood tubes with expiration dates ranging from December 2001 to May 2002. These expiration dates refer only to the vacuum used in the tubes to draw blood. The replacement blood tubes that are currently available will also expire in a few months. For this reason, FRA will delay replacement of the expiring tubes until completely new lots of 18-24 month blood tubes become available in early 2002. This notice explains the procedures to be followed until the replacement of these expiring blood tubes is complete. These temporary procedures will not compromise either the quality or integrity of any test results. | 2001-12-31 | 2001 | 12 | https://www.federalregister.gov/documents/2001/12/31/01-32048/alcoholdrug-regulations-temporary-post-accident-blood-testing-procedures | https://www.govinfo.gov/content/pkg/FR-2001-12-31/pdf/01-32048.pdf | Transportation Department; Federal Railroad Administration | 492,185 | Some of the existing FRA post-accident toxicology testing (PATT) kits contain blood tubes with expiration dates ranging from December 2001 to May 2002. | 01-32173 | Parts and Accessories Necessary for Safe Operation; Manufactured Home Tires | Rule | The FMCSA is amending its tire regulation to reflect the expiration of a provision allowing the overloading of tires used for the transportation of manufactured homes. The agency is also denying petitions from the Manufactured Housing Institute (MHI) for rulemaking and for an extension of the expiration date of the overloading provision, and from Multinational Legal Services, PLLC (Multinational Legal Services), for rescission of an earlier extension of the expiration date. Currently, tires used in the transportation of manufactured homes may be loaded up to 18 percent over the load rating marked on the sidewall of the tires, or in the absence of such a marking, 18 percent above the load rating specified in publications of certain organizations specializing in tires. The rule was scheduled to expire--thus prohibiting tire overloading--on November 21, 2000, unless extended by joint agreement of FMCSA and the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D). The expiration date was delayed until December 31, 2001, to give the agency enough time to complete its review of the MHI's petition to allow 18-percent overloading on a permanent basis. | 01-32254 | Imposition and Collection of Passenger Civil Aviation Security Service Fees | Rule | The Transportation Security Administration (TSA) announces the imposition of a security service fee in the amount of $2.50 per enplanement on passengers of domestic and foreign air carriers in air transportation, foreign air transportation, and intrastate air transportation originating at airports in the United States. Passengers will not be charged for more than two enplanements per one-way trip or four enplanements per round trip. The security service fee will apply to passengers using frequent flyer awards for air transportation, but may not be imposed on other nonrevenue passengers. Direct air carriers and foreign air carriers must collect the security service fees on air transportation sold on or after February 1, 2002.
